Letting your bridesmaids have too much freedom sometimes backfires. It's important to define what you want. If you'd like them in floor-length dresses, be sure to tell them that. If you're wearing a strapless gown and, therefore, want them to wear sleeves, make that clear. If you give them guidelines while letting them know that you are concerned with how they feel, they will be happy to please you.
The Accessories
Okay, so the hard part is over: You've chosen the dresses. But you're not in the clear yet! There are all sorts of other decisions that need to be made. What type of jewelry should your bridesmaids have on? What shoes? Do you want them to wear stockings? If so, what color? To deal with these issues without losing your mind, first consider the overall look you would like to achieve. Do you want all your bridesmaids to look the same, or do you want their personalities and differences to show? Then think about what the most important items are to you and what pieces they likely already have.
